At the top of the logo, the C on the right comes in front of the C on the left. At the bottom, the C on the right passes behind the one on the left. You can tell the bag is fake if the logo is flat or not perfectly centered vertically and horizontally on the leather flap.

Eight digit serial number printed on white sticker covered with clear tape with two Chanel logos."X" cut-lines prevent sticker from being removed without damage. "CHANEL" appears on rightright side of the sticker. Dark line appears on left side of sticker. Gold speckles appear throughout sticker.
Authentic Chanel dust bags should be made of white cotton with a black drawstring or black felt with white lettering, with a distinctly soft feel and a sharply printed, centered logo using the original font.

By the 1970s and 1980s, the Mademoiselle lock was phased out in benefício of the interlocking CC closure.
An authentic Chanel bag will have matching serial numbers on both the bag and its authenticity card ; any discrepancy between these two is an indication of a fake bag.
